TURIN, ITALY - CIRCA OCTOBER 2018: Cappella della Sindone meaning Holy Shroud chapel at Turin Cathedral


Size: 4608px × 3456px
Photo credit: © stockeurope / Alamy / Afripics
License: Royalty Free
Model Released: No

Keywords: 2018, architecture, building, cappella, cathedral, chapel, church, city, cityscape, della, duomo, editorial, eu, europe, european, holy, italia, italian, italy, landmark, piedmont, piemonte, shroud, sindone, torino, town, turin, urban